Infra de A à Z - 15. Intégrer ansible dans terraform

Sdílet
Vložit
  • čas přidán 13. 04. 2024
  • Site infomaniak : www.infomaniak.com/fr
    VOD :
    Comment débuter sur une infrastructure cloud ? hors gafam ? Comment assembler les technologies nécessaires pour monitorer cette infrastructure ?
    Comment automatiser avec simplicité cette infrastructure ?
    A travers cette série de vidéos, je vous propose de découvrir une suggestion de "squelette" pour créer votre propre infrastructure et surtout d'apprendre à utiliser les technologie nécessaire pour cela.
    Du provisionning à la configuration, de l'automatisation au monitoring, je vous propose de mettre en place les bases pour vous permettre d'aller plus loin.
    #cloud #opensource #formation #openstack
    Code : gitlab.com/xavki/infrastructu...
    📽️ Abonnez-vous : bit.ly/2UnOdgi
    🖥️ Devenir membre VIP : bit.ly/3dItQU9
    👂 Podcast : podcast.ausha.co/xavki/
    Sommaire de plus de 1500 vidéos :
    - sur github : bit.ly/2P5x8Xj
    - sur gitlab : bit.ly/2BvYouO
    ➡️ ➡️ Vous voulez m'encourager likez la vidéo, commentez-là et abonnez-vous ! 😃
  • Věda a technologie

Komentáře • 17

  • @cedriccuvelier5246
    @cedriccuvelier5246 Před 2 měsíci +1

    check, effectivement avec un sleep ca marche du premier coup. Merci Xavier 😃

    • @xavki
      @xavki  Před 2 měsíci

      cool c'est pas beau mais ça marche

  • @pierrickjje-ih4ye
    @pierrickjje-ih4ye Před 2 měsíci +1

    Nickel ;-) merci encore
    Pour info supp, après ajout de la resource "null", un petit terraform init -update
    ssh toujours ok
    J'oubliais : cote infomaniak, 0,28 € de dépenser ;-)

  • @msdos911
    @msdos911 Před 2 měsíci

    Effectivement le "depends_on" ne suffit pas, j'ai mis un "sleep 15" pour que tout passe sans relancer une seconde fois.
    Pour infomaniak y a encore de la marge 0.11€.

    • @xavki
      @xavki  Před 2 měsíci

      Ah yes. Cool record 🎉

  • @DamienCarpentier
    @DamienCarpentier Před měsícem +1

    L'inverse est plus pratique, Terraform piloté par Ansible 😎

    • @xavki
      @xavki  Před měsícem

      Chaise place a une chose chaque chose à une place 🤣. Dans notre cas de figure non 😉

    • @HiPh0Plover1
      @HiPh0Plover1 Před měsícem +1

      @@xavki pourquoi exactement, peux tu développer ?

    • @xavki
      @xavki  Před měsícem +1

      L'idée de cette playlist est d'être pédagogique en expliquant le pattern standard et d'avoir quelque chose d'assez simple à comprendre. L'utilisation de ansible sur terraform est nettement moins courant même s'il dispose d'atouts sympas.

  • @alexy74100
    @alexy74100 Před 2 měsíci +1

    Hello, Je ne sais pas si je suis le seul mais j ai des soucis avec la ressources null_ressource , j ai teste sur 2 machines.
    Il n arrive pas a lancer les commandes sur la machine local
    null_resource.openvpn_server (local-exec): /bin/sh: 1:
    Error: local-exec provisioner error

    │ with null_resource.openvpn_server,
    │ on 06_ansible.tf line 5, in resource "null_resource" "openvpn_server":
    │ 5: provisioner "local-exec" {

    │ Error running command 'echo > /tmp/openvpn.ini;
    : not foundtatus 127. Output: /bin/sh: 1:

    • @xavki
      @xavki  Před 2 měsíci +1

      Utilise tu linux ? As tu ansible d'installé ? Essaie de reproduire les commandes

    • @alexy74100
      @alexy74100 Před 2 měsíci +1

      OK je m auto reponds. ca vient des retours chariots qui sont configuré en CRLF au lieu de LF dans mon visual code .
      Merci pour le travail en tous cas Xavier. C est génial comme support pour apprendre

    • @alexy74100
      @alexy74100 Před 2 měsíci +1

      @@xavki j ai écris la réponse en même temps , sur mon 2 eme pc, j utilise Windows en env de dev , un soucis avec les retours chariots

    • @xavki
      @xavki  Před 2 měsíci

      Ok cool